Sargatskoye (Russian: Сарга́тское), colloquially known as Sargatka (Сарга́тка),[citation needed] is an urban locality (a work settlement) and the administrative center of Sargatsky District of Omsk Oblast, Russia, located 75 kilometers (47 mi) north of Omsk along the Irtysh River. Population: 8,157 (2010 Russian census);[1] 8,386 (2002 Census);[4] 8,677 (1989 Soviet census).[5]
